• Title/Summary/Keyword: Machine System

검색결과 8,774건 처리시간 0.034초

UML State Machine Diagram을 이용한 소프트웨어 시스템의 데드락 탐지 (Deadlock Detection of Software System Using UML State Machine Diagram)

  • 민현석
    • 중소기업융합학회논문지
    • /
    • 제1권1호
    • /
    • pp.75-83
    • /
    • 2011
  • Unified Modeling Language (UML)는 산업계에서 소프트웨어 설계 표준 언어로서 인정되고 있으며 특히 UML State Machine Diagram은 클래스의 동적인 행위(behavior)를 묘사하는데 많이 사용되고 있다. 이 논문은 UML State Machine Diagram을를 이용하여 시스템의 데드락 (deadlock)을 찾는 방법에 대해서 논한다. 보통 State Machine Diagram는 개별의 클래스의 행위를 나타내는 데 사용되므로 시스템 범위의 행위를 알고 싶으면 시스템에 있는 클래스들 중 관심 있는 클래스들의 State Machine Diagram을 합하여 시스템의 행위를 나타낼 수 있는 State Machine Diagram이 필요하여진다. 일반적으로 이러한 시스템 수준의 State Machine Diagram은 매우 복잡하고 실제로는 타당하지 않은 State나 Transition들을 포함하게 된다. 실제 시스템의 행위를 나타내기 위해서 synchronization과 externalization을 적용하여 State Machine Diagram을 유효한 수준으로 줄이는 것이 필요하다. 이렇게 만들어진 State Machine Diagram은 시스템의 행위를 나타내는데 사용될 수 있으며 통상의 모델 체킹 방법이 적용될 수 있다. 이 논문은 데드락 탐지를 하는 방법을 간단한 예제를 통해서 보여준다. 모든 과정은 툴에서 자동으로 지원되며 필요한 알고리즘도 같이 설명된다.

  • PDF

공작기계지능화를 위한 에이전트 기반 의사결정지원시스템 (Agent-Based Decision Support System for Intelligent Machine Tools)

  • 이승우;송준엽;이화기;김선호
    • 산업경영시스템학회지
    • /
    • 제29권1호
    • /
    • pp.87-93
    • /
    • 2006
  • In order to implement Artificial Intelligence, various technologies have been widely used. Artificial Intelligence are applied for many industrial products and machine tools are the center of manufacturing devices in intelligent manufacturing devices. The purpose of this paper is to present the design of Decision Support Agent that is applicable to machine tools. This system is that decision whether to act in accordance with machine status is support system. It communicates with other active agents such as sensory and dialogue agent. The proposed design of decision support agent facilitates the effective operation and control of machine tools and provides a systematic way to integrate the expert's knowledge that will implement Intelligent Machine Tools.

지능공작기계 지식구조의 규칙베이스 구축 (Constructing Rule Base of knowledge structure for Intelligent Machine Tools)

  • 이승우;김동훈;임선종;송준엽;이화기
    • 한국정밀공학회:학술대회논문집
    • /
    • 한국정밀공학회 2005년도 추계학술대회 논문집
    • /
    • pp.954-957
    • /
    • 2005
  • In order to implement Artificial Intelligence, various technologies have been widely used. Artificial Intelligence is applied for many industrial product and machine tools are the center of manufacturing devices in intelligent manufacturing system. The purpose of this paper is to present the construction of Rule Base for knowledge structure that is applicable to machine tools. This system is that decision whether to act in accordance with machine status is support system. It constructs Rule Base of knowledge used of machine toots. The constructed Rule Base facilitates the effective operation and control of machine tools and will provide a systematic way to integrate the expert's knowledge that will apply Intelligent Machine Tools.

  • PDF

공작기계 시스템의 모델링과 동적 특성 분석 (Modelling and dynamic analysis of electro-mechanical system in machine tools)

  • 박용환;신흥철;문희성;최종률
    • 한국정밀공학회:학술대회논문집
    • /
    • 한국정밀공학회 1995년도 추계학술대회 논문집
    • /
    • pp.991-994
    • /
    • 1995
  • Recent trend in machine tools is pursuing the high precision and high speed facility and its architecture is being more complicated. With this tendency, it is required the more precise dynamic analysis of electro-mechanical system in machine tools. In this paper, the exact mathematical model of feed and spindle system of a typical machine tools was induced. The feed system is modeled as 7-mass system including the workpiece and the spindle system as 4-mass system. The simulation results show that the induced model depicts the characteristics of real system very well. The effects of each mechanical element to dynamic motion of a machine are analyzed by simulation with the induced model. It ia anticipated that the induced model can be used in the analysis of various machine architectures and in the design stage of new machine tools.

  • PDF

상관관계 해석을 고려한 온 더 머신 자동측정 시스템 (Measuring Automation System for Analysis of Dimensional Reationships On the Machine)

  • 정성종
    • 한국공작기계학회:학술대회논문집
    • /
    • 한국공작기계학회 1996년도 춘계학술대회 논문집
    • /
    • pp.183-187
    • /
    • 1996
  • On the machine measuring system composed of touch trigger probes, a DNC module, a CMM module, an analysis module and a man-machine interface unit was developed. Measuring accuracy is affected by working accuracy of the on the machine measuring system. The working accuracy of the system is due to geometric errors of th machine tool, servo errors of feed drives and positioning errors of probes. In order to compensate for the measuring errors due to the working accuracy, a calibration module was developed. The measuring automation system was realized with the on the machine measuring system and an IBM-PC on the machine center through a RS-232C. It turns the machining machine (CMM). The system is used for dimensional checking of machined components. initial job setup, part identification, identification of machining errors due to deflection and wear of tools. cutter run out, and calibration of machine tools. A horizontal machining center equipped with FANUC OMC wre used for verification of the system. The validity and reliability of the system. The validity and reliability of the system were confirmed through a series of experiments with gage blocks, ring gages, comparison measurement with a commercial CMM, and so on.

  • PDF

CORBA를 이용한 가상기계에서의 고장진단에 관한 연구 (Fault Diagnosis in a Virtual Machine using CORBA)

  • 서정완;강무진;정순철;김성환
    • 한국정밀공학회:학술대회논문집
    • /
    • 한국정밀공학회 1997년도 추계학술대회 논문집
    • /
    • pp.109-114
    • /
    • 1997
  • As CNC machine tool is one of core elements of manufacturing system, it is much important that it remains without troubleshoots. As a virtual machine is a recent alternative using IT for optimal utilization of CNC machine tool, it is a computer model that represents a CNC machine tool. But a virtual machine is still conceptual. So, in this paper, it is proposed that a virtual machine be a realistic model in the fault diagnosis module. For this purpose, the fault diagnosis system of machine tool using CORBA and fault diagnosis expert system has been implemented. Using this system, we have expections to diagnose exactly and prompty without the restriction of time or location, to reduce MTTR(Mean Time To Repair) and finally to increase the availability of manufacturing system.

  • PDF

공작기계 구조물 설계를 위한 통합설계 시스템 개발 (Development of Integrated Design System for Structural Design of Machine Tools)

  • 박면웅;손영태;조성원
    • 한국정밀공학회지
    • /
    • 제20권1호
    • /
    • pp.229-239
    • /
    • 2003
  • The design process of machine tools is regarded as a sequential, discrete, and inefficient works as it requires various kinds of design tools and many working hours. This paper describes an integrated design system embedding a design methodology that can support efficiently and systematically the conceptual structural design of machine tools. The system is a knowledge-based design system and has four machine-tool-specific functional modules including configuration design, configuration analysis, structure design, and structural analysis support module. Through the configuration design and analysis module, a machine configuration appropriate for design requirements is selected, and then the arrangement of ribs fer each structural part is decided in the structure design module. Also, the structural analysis support module is used to evaluate design result by utilizing structural analysis software, ANSYS. The system is applied to design of a tapping machine, and shows that the machine structure can be designed fast and conveniently by processing each design step interactively.

충격력 에 의한 공작기계 동특성 규명 연구 (A Study on Indentification of Machine Tool Dynamics by Impulse Shock)

  • 신민재;이종원
    • 대한기계학회논문집
    • /
    • 제7권2호
    • /
    • pp.138-144
    • /
    • 1983
  • To evaluate the dynamic characteristics of machine tool system, the system is modelled as a closed-loop system composed of cutting process and improved machine tool structures. The proposed machine tool structure model is constructed in consideration of energy transfer through the system. A new methodology to identify the machine tool dynamics by adopting impulse response and impulse cutting techniques is also proposed. It is shown that the methodology is successfully applied to a machine tool system to identify its dynamic characteristics employing the improved model.

Grid Encoder를 이용한 NC공작기계 동적정밀도 측정에 관한 연구 (A Study on Measurement of Dynamic Accuracy Using Grid Encoder in NC Machine Tools)

  • 이찬호;이방희;김성청
    • 한국정밀공학회:학술대회논문집
    • /
    • 한국정밀공학회 2003년도 춘계학술대회 논문집
    • /
    • pp.378-381
    • /
    • 2003
  • Efficient development of method on a performance evaluation for machine tools has been regarded as the most important work for accuracy and quality enhancement to every user and manufacturer. A evaluation method of accuracy for machine tools has been studied recently according to the rapid increase of interest in precision machine tools. To this point of view, the circular interpolation test of machine tools is recognized as the most useful method to distinguish a dynamic accuracy of NC machine tools by ISO and ANSI/ASME, etc. In this paper, we have studied and developed the form measurement system with grid encoder to analyse the final accuracy of NC machine tools. we have analyzed the servo system error and geometric error of NC machine tools through measuring a dynamic error signal by this system. and then we verified the experimental result and enhanced the reliability by means of comparing the characteristics of the developed system with the kinematic ball-bar system.

  • PDF